Product Description:

The SD-B5.250.015-14.000 is an electric drive element built by Bosch Rexroth Indramat for the SD Magnet Motors series. Designed for closed-loop motion platforms, the unit translates command currents from a compatible inverter into proportional rotary displacement. By supplying controlled torque and speed, it serves as a core actuator for pick-and-place axes, conveyor sections, and other automated stations that require repeatable positioning under variable load. Its compact flange interface simplifies installation in machinery frames where space and weight are constrained, and mechanical feedback devices can be coupled to the shaft to relay motion data to higher-level controllers. This arrangement is useful in indexing tables and transfer modules where repeated starts, stops, and reversals are common.

The motor uses Ferrite magnetic material, giving a stable magnetic circuit without rare-earth temperature drift. A square, ISO-standard face provides a 116 mm mounting flange so it can bolt directly to planetary gearboxes or pillow-block supports. Continuous rotation is rated at 1500 rpm, which suits moderate-speed machinery and direct-coupled motion stages. At zero speed, the stator can sustain 25 Nm of holding torque, allowing vertical loads to remain fixed while the drive is energized. Motion is transferred through a cylindrical shaft machined to 19 mm diameter by 40 mm, a size that matches common clamp collars and keyway hubs.

The unit is a brushless servo motor, so commutation is handled through electronic commutation and the rotor does not require brush maintenance. This layout supports smooth low-speed response and consistent torque production when used with a compatible inverter. Because there are no brushes to wear, routine service is limited to the surrounding mechanical components rather than electrical contact parts. It also avoids brush dust inside the housing, which is useful in enclosed machine spaces. The motor can be paired with external feedback hardware at the shaft when an application requires position or speed data for the control loop.

Flange Size
116 mm
Magnet Type
Ferrite
Nominal Speed
1500 rpm
Product Type
Brushless servo motor
Shaft Dimensions
ø 19x40 mm
Special Version
None
Torque at Standstill
25 Nm
